Bancon Homes launches new Aberdeen development

A SCOTS city that was ranked bottom for economic output and employment three years ago has received a new development of luxury homes.

Bancon Homes has launched the site of luxury homes in Aberdeen, which will be named Kinion Heights.

This coincides with a more than £1.1m contibution to the local economy, by the company, to help fund schools in the area, as well as recreation and healthcare facilities, and upgrades to the transport network.

Depsite being on the bottom of the list of cities for the best economic output and employment in 2021, the Granite City can be seen to be making strides to move away from their “mixed fortune” image through such developments.

Positive changes were made evident by PwC’s Good Growth of Cities Index, which placed Aberdeen as the sixth most improved city on the list in 2023, in terms of employment and ratio of house prices to earnings.

Picture of Bancon Homes development plans
The Fernielea house is currently in development for Kinion Heights. Credits: Bancon Homes

This new community is the next phase in Bancon Homes’ Kilion Place development, which sold out after strong demand.

Kinion Heights will be located on the hillside between Newshills and Craibstone, and will consist of 63 two, three and four-bedroom houses designed in one of 14 contemporary house styles.

Bancon Homes said they have created houses ideal for all types of buyers, and the area will have great transport links as it is situated 15 minutes from the city centre and five minutes away from the airport.

Each home is also expected to have an EPC Band B energy efficiency rating.

The first phase of three and four-bedroomed houses are already for sale, with prices starting at £259,995.

Bancon Homes sales director, Jo Skinner, said: “We are excited to bring this special new development of stunning homes to the market as part of an already thriving new community in Aberdeen.

“Interest has been high and we have received a significant level of enquiries, which we only expect to increase now we have officially launched.

“Our sales team is on site ready to welcome visitors and work is well underway on our new show home and sales centre which will be opening later this year.”
